Profile

Veeco Instruments Inc. is a global manufacturer of advanced semiconductor process equipment used to solve complex materials engineering challenges. The company provides high-volume manufacturing solutions including ion beam, laser annealing, and chemical vapor deposition technologies essential for fabricating AI chips, 5G components, and data storage devices. Its core value proposition centers on combining deep applications expertise with systems engineering to deliver a competitive cost of ownership for the semiconductor and photonics industries.

Competitive position

A leading provider of specialized ion beam and laser annealing technologies with a significant global footprint in advanced node semiconductor manufacturing.
